AI is professionalizing how enterprises communicate

For startups, mastering communication is no longer just about persuasion—it’s about scalability. As companies grow, the ability to consistently translate complex ideas into clear, compelling narratives becomes a competitive advantage. Yet, for most startups, access to high-quality communication expertise remains out of reach. This is the gap Prezent is aiming to close.

Founded in 2021 by Rajat Mishra, Prezent is building an AI-powered communication platform designed to replace slow, expensive agency models with a system that blends artificial intelligence, domain-specific software, and human expertise. Headquartered in Los Altos, the company works with enterprises across life sciences, technology, and manufacturing—industries where precision, compliance, and clarity are critical.

This month, Prezent announced a strategic partnership with Tom McCarthy, one of the world’s most respected high-stakes presentation coaches, signaling a new phase in how AI can be used to professionalize and scale business communication.

From static decks to AI-powered coaching

McCarthy, founder of FIRE-UP Training, has coached executives at companies such as Cisco, Microsoft, Salesforce, Zoom, and Wells Fargo. Earlier in his career, while leading sales and marketing at Robbins Research International, he developed the FIRE-UP Your Presentations System—an approach credited with driving a 200% increase in sales.

Now, that methodology is being translated into AI-powered communication coaching avatars within the Prezent platform.

Unlike generic AI writing tools, Prezent’s avatars offer real-time coaching, structured frameworks, and actionable feedback tailored to specific industries and business contexts. The goal is not to generate slides faster, but to institutionalize best-in-class communication across teams.

“The future of communication will be powered by technology but guided by humanity,” said McCarthy, describing the rationale behind the partnership.

The announcement comes shortly after Prezent raised an additional $30 million in funding, earmarked largely for acquisitions. The company positions itself as a disruptor of the traditional $20 billion agency and consultancy market, offering measurable ROI to enterprise customers—particularly within F2000 life sciences and technology firms.

Prezent’s platform can process complex clinical or technical data and turn it into contextualized, brand-aligned presentations in minutes rather than weeks. Through APIs and presentation agents, teams can integrate communication workflows directly into their existing systems, effectively creating what the company calls a “Company Presentation Brain.”

As AI moves deeper into enterprise operations, Prezent’s approach highlights a shift: communication is no longer a soft skill—it’s becoming core infrastructure.
